package logging import ( "sync" "time" ) // Level classifies the severity of a log entry. type Level int const ( LevelInfo Level = iota LevelWarn LevelError ) // Entry is a single log record. type Entry struct { Ts int64 Level Level Source string Message string Details string } // Logger is a thread-safe ring-buffer log with cap 500. type Logger struct { mu sync.Mutex buf []Entry listeners []func(Entry) now func() int64 } const bufCap = 500 // NewLogger creates a Logger with a 500-entry ring buffer. func NewLogger() *Logger { return &Logger{ now: func() int64 { return time.Now().UnixMilli() }, } } func (l *Logger) add(level Level, source, message string, details []string) { var d string if len(details) > 0 { d = details[0] } e := Entry{ Ts: l.now(), Level: level, Source: source, Message: message, Details: d, } l.mu.Lock() l.buf = append(l.buf, e) if len(l.buf) > bufCap { l.buf = l.buf[len(l.buf)-bufCap:] } fns := l.listeners l.mu.Unlock() for _, fn := range fns { fn(e) } } // Info records an info-level entry. func (l *Logger) Info(source, message string, details ...string) { l.add(LevelInfo, source, message, details) } // Warn records a warn-level entry. func (l *Logger) Warn(source, message string, details ...string) { l.add(LevelWarn, source, message, details) } // Error records an error-level entry. func (l *Logger) Error(source, message string, details ...string) { l.add(LevelError, source, message, details) } // Snapshot returns a copy of all buffered entries, oldest first. func (l *Logger) Snapshot() []Entry { l.mu.Lock() out := make([]Entry, len(l.buf)) copy(out, l.buf) l.mu.Unlock() return out } // Subscribe registers fn to be called for every new entry. func (l *Logger) Subscribe(fn func(Entry)) { l.mu.Lock() l.listeners = append(l.listeners, fn) l.mu.Unlock() } // Default is the package-level logger instance. var Default = NewLogger()
